I would not see why not. I think it would be a pretty good match. They are not torque monster engines but offer some decent top end which is more what you need anyway.
 
May need motor mounts. The shaft could be longer and may have to re adjust the motor back a few centimeters and engine could be taller.

---------- Post added at 1:00 PM ---------- Previous post was at 12:56 PM ----------

By looking at it correctly, it will not be a direct fit. Motor mounts will be needed and also a pivot nut. You cannot use the pivot shaft any more.
